In this work we investigate how the permanent loss of the household head from the household affects children's school enrolment and work participation in rural Colombia. We consider losses that are due to death or divorce, and that we can therefore be confident are adverse events. We are interested in school and work participation because it is well-known that they affect crucially the human capital accumulation of children, though we should point out that we measure only short-term impacts in this work.
